Description
Rev. Winfred B. Schaller was a leader in the creation of the Church of Lutheran Confession (CLC). He served as editor of the
CLC's first periodical,
The Lutheran Spokesman, from June 1958 until he was forced to resign in August 1970. He left the CLC in 1972 and finished his ministry in service
to a congregation of the Missouri Synod in Indio, California.
Background
Winfred B. Schaller Jr. (December 16, 1922 - March 4, 1983) was a Lutheran minister and leader in the Church of Lutheran Confession
(CLC). Due to unresolved differences with the leaders and sensing that he no longer represented the thinking of the CLC, he
left the organization in 1972.
